What Are AI Agents for Content Creation?
AI agents are advanced software systems powered by artificial intelligence that can autonomously perform tasks like:
- Researching topics
- Generating content
- Editing and optimizing
- Publishing and distributing
Unlike traditional tools, AI agents don’t just assist—they act.
They are built on technologies like:
- Machine Learning
- Natural Language Processing
- Large Language Models

How AI Agents Work in Content Creation
AI agents follow a structured workflow:
Step 1: Input & Goal Setting
You define:
- Topic
- Keywords
- Audience
Step 2: Research
The AI gathers data from:
- SERPs
- Competitors
- Existing content
Step 3: Content Generation
Using large language models, the AI creates content.
Step 4: Optimization
The content is refined for:
- SEO
- Readability
- Engagement
Step 5: Publishing
Some agents can publish content automatically.

Challenges and Limitations
AI agents are powerful—but not perfect.
1. Lack of Human Creativity
AI may lack emotional depth.
2. Risk of Generic Content
Without guidance, content can feel repetitive.
3. Fact-Checking Required
AI can make mistakes—always verify.
Best Practices for Using AI Agents
1. Combine AI with Human Editing
Use AI for drafts, humans for refinement.
2. Provide Clear Prompts
The better your input, the better the output.
3. Focus on Value
Avoid mass-producing low-quality content.
4. Optimize for Search Intent
Always align with what users want.
